Oedipus, in Greek mythology, the king of Thebes who unwittingly killed his father and married his mother. Homer related that Oedipus’s wife and mother hanged herself when the truth of their relationship became known, though Oedipus apparently continued to rule at Thebes until his death.

Oedipus’ original encounter with Tiresias at the beginning of the play Oedipus the King is an Athenian tragedy by Sophocles and was first performed in 429 BCE. It is second in line of Sophocless three Theban plays and features Oedipus as a brave, young protagonist.

Although we never see the oracle at Delphi, she is essential in providing foreshadowing for the plot of Oedipus the King. In Greek culture, an oracle was a priest or priestess who would receive and relay messages from the gods.

Oedipus the King is a tragic play, written by Sophocles that develops the important theme of blindness, through King Oedipus’ personal story.It takes place in an ancient Greek city called Thebes, and begins with a king named Oedipus who has just taken over. The previous king, Laius, was murdered just prior to Oedipus’ arrival.He is married to the widowed queen of Thebes, Jocasta, and rules.
